William Feng (piano/composition), 16, lives in Plymouth, Minnesota, and is a tenth grader at Wayzata High School. William has studied piano at the Macphail Center for Music for the past ten years and is currently studying with Richard Tostenson. He has also studied composition for six years with Sarah Miller.

Making his concerto debut in 2022 and solo recital debut in 2023, William has won prizes in many competitions, including the Margaret Ankeny Award at the Minnesota Orchestra’s Young People’s Concerto Competition, Third Place at the La Crosse Rising Stars Concerto Competition, Second Place at the St. Paul Piano Concerto Competition, First Place at the MMTA Young Artist competition, First Place at the Minneapolis Music Teachers Forum Mozart Piano Concerto Competition, and First Place at the Schubert Club Competition.

He has attended masterclasses with Reiko Imrie, Susan Billmeyer, Evren Ozel, and Inna Faliks. As a composer, William has written pieces for the Minnesota Sinfonia, Ivalas String Quartet, Riverside Winds, and Minnesota Percussion Trio, winning second prize at the National Federation of Music Clubs National competition. As a violist, William is part of the MMEA All-State Orchestra and the Greater Twin Cities Youth Symphony, and is preparing for a tour in Australia and New Zealand in 2026.

Outside of music, William enjoys running and cooking.
